摘要

目的 探讨测定不同产地玫瑰香葡萄藤茎中白藜芦醇和ε-葡萄素的含量的方法。方法 采用高效液相色谱法测定不同产地葡萄藤中白藜芦醇和ε-葡萄素的含量,并做加样回收率实验。色谱柱为COSMOSIL 5C18-MS-Ⅱ(4.6ID ×250 mm);流动相为甲醇-醋酸水溶液进行梯度洗脱,流速1 ml/min,柱温30 ℃,检测波长为254 nm和310 nm。结果 白藜芦醇在1.76~17.6 μg质量范围内与峰面积呈现良好的线性关系(R2=0.9999);ε-葡萄素在2.75~27.54 μg范围内与峰面积呈现良好的线性关系(R2=0.9999)。利用该方法测定10个样品中的白藜芦醇的含量范围在1.94~5.96 μg/g,含量的变异系数为40.64%;ε-葡萄素的含量范围在8.74~15.41 μg/g,含量的变异系数为17.67%。结论 该方法简便易行,结果准确,可作为控制葡萄藤质量的方法。

Abstract

Objective To determine the contents of resveratrol and ε-viniferin in the stems of muscat grape vines grown in different areas.Methods High performance liquid chromatography was applied to determine the contents with a mobile phase that consisted of methanol-acetic acid aqueous solution by gradient elution. The wavelength of detection was 310 nm and 254 nm respectively, the flow rate was 1 mL/min, and the column temperature was 30 ℃. Results The linear relationships of resveratrol and ε-viniferin were good in the range of 1.76 to 17.6 μg and 2.75 to 27.54 μg respectively(R2=0.9999). The contents of resveratrol and ε-viniferin determined with this method ranged from 1.94 to 5.96μg/g and 8.74 to 15.41 μg/g in ten samples, while their coefficients of variation were 40.64% and 17.67%, respectively.Conclusions This method is simple, accurate and can be used to for quality control of grape vines.
